Abstract
“Is it ever okay to laugh with your callers on a suicide prevention line?”
I have asked myself this question a few times while working on crisis lines for the better part of five years.
On the one hand, I can understand arguments for avoiding humor in a crisis. On the other, well-timed humor has shown remarkable power in various crisis situations, from convincing people to open the door to assistance in a domestic dispute, to reducing tensions in heated business meetings.
